Missions
On her first mission Shannon was a crew member on STS 51-G,
which launched from the Kennedy Space Center, Florida, on June
17, 1985. Following 112 orbits of the Earth in 169 hours and 39
seconds, STS 51-G landed at Edwards Air Force Base, California,
on June 24, 1985.
Shannon next flew on the crew of STS-34, which launched from
Kennedy Space Center, Florida, on October 18, 1989. After 79
orbits of the Earth in 119 hours and 41 minutes, STS-34 landed at
Edwards Air Force Base, California, on October 23, 1989.
Shannon then served on the crew of STS-43, which launched
from Kennedy Space Center, Florida, on August 2, 1991. After 142
orbits of the Earth in 213 hours, the mission concluded with the
landing on Runway 15 at Kennedy Space Center on August 11, 1991.
Shannon was a crew member of STS-58, which launched from
Kennedy Space Center on October 18, 1993. The mission was
accomplished in 225 orbits of the Earth in 336 hours, 13 minutes,
01 second, STS-58 landed at Edwards Air Force Base on November 1,
1993.
More recently Shannon was selected to be a crew member aboard
Russia's Space Station Mir. Her journey started with liftoff from
Kennedy Space Center, Florida, on March 22, 1996 aboard STS-76.
Following docking, she transferred to Mir Space Station. Her
return journey to KSC was made aboard STS-79 on September 26,
1996. Shannon traveled 75.2 million miles in 188 days, 04 hours,
00 minutes, 14 seconds.
